Method
Biscuits
- 1
Preheat the oven
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
- 2
Mix dry 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t until well combined.
- 3
Cut in butter
Add the cold unsalted butter to the dry ingredients. Use a pastry cutter or your fingers to cut the butter into the flour mixture until it resembles coarse crumbs.
- 4
Add buttermilk
Pour in the buttermilk and stir gently until just combined. Do not overmix.
- 5
Shape biscuits
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face. Pat it into a 1-inch thick rectangle. Use a biscuit cutter to cut out rounds and place them on a baking sheet.
- 6
Bake
Bake in the preheated oven for about 12-15 minutes or until golden brown on top.
Gravy
- 7
Cook sausage
In a large skillet over medium heat, add the ground sausage. Cook until browned and cooked through, breaking it up with a spatula.
- 8
Make a roux
Once the sausage is cooked, sprinkle the tablespoon of flour over the sausage and stir well to combine. Cook for an additional 1-2 minutes.
- 9
Add milk
Slowly pour in the milk while continuously stirring to avoid lumps.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
- 10
Season and thicken
Continue cooking and stirring until the gravy thickens, about 5-7 minutes. Season with black pepper and salt to taste.
